Sandy Struckhoff, founder and owner of
Corvette Sandy Productions & Golden Sand Records, was born in Southern
California. Sandy attended private school and was raised in the Los
Angeles area. Growing up with the classic California music scene; she has
acquired an intimate knowledge of the many diverse musical styles. With
strong work ethics and diligence, Sandy has created her own talent agency
and record label. She is the first woman to executive-produce her own
compilation Surf Music CD on her own label. A release that sold out in the
first 6 months! Sandy's son is also an accomplished musician and has
played with several surf bands. Also, Sandy is an eloquent public speaker
and a skilled creative writer, and has her own column called "Corvette
Sandy's Garage"!
